    Magande calls for financial education from elementary school level

    FORMER Finance Minister Ng’andu Magande has called for the introduction of financial education in schools, saying this will help curb misappropriation of public funds because children will be taught how to handle money from an early stage.     COF, ZICTA enter consent judgement in internet shutdown case

    CHAPTER One Foundation Limited says it has entered into a consent judgement with ZICTA in a matter in which it was challenging the authority's decision to order mobile service providers to cease providing internet services as well as blocking access to WhatsApp and Facebook in August last year.     I’ve never engaged in any sexual activities with Mercy, Bowman tells court

    FORMER Lusaka Province minister Bowman Lusambo has submitted that a DNA test will be the only sure way to determine the paternity of Mercy Cowham's four children because he has never engaged in any sexual activity with her.     Forgiveness doesn’t mean lack of accountability – Musa

    FORMER Attorney General Musa Mwenye State Counsel says individuals who have served in government but have unexplained wealth must still account for it, whether there is reconciliation or not.
